2022 Black History Month Commemoration
Truly Alive Youth and Family Foundation Inc invites members of Saskatoon diverse Black communities and the public the 2022 Black History Month commemoration under the umbrella theme Black Health and Wellness.
Over the years, Truly Alive Youth and Family Foundation Inc has hosted month-long Black History celebrations each February, showcasing Black excellence and addressing age-long social issues requiring lasting solutions.
In concert with local reality in Greater Saskatoon Metropolitan Area, the 2022 Black History Month Planning Committee with membership drawn from diverse Saskatoon Black communities and walks of life, has identified “STRONGER TOGETHER” as our local theme with a lineup of virtual events/activities connecting both the umbrella theme and our local theme.
This year’s event will engage Government-level representatives and erudite Black academic/subject matter experts in Saskatoon, and nationally. All events will be delivered virtually in consideration of COVID-19.

Truly Alive Youth and Family Foundation Inc is a conduit for Saskatoon Black Canadian Alliance Network – a working group comprising Afro-Caribbean membership with a focus on improving social, health, political, and economic outcomes of Black individuals and families in the Greater Saskatoon Metropolis.
